It's a restrictive practice only allowing fans to sell via the ticket exchange when it is sold out and even when Arsenal do open the exchange they can sell only at the listed price. They should be like twickets when people can list at any price up to face value regardless of the club sales. It is also wrong that ticket transfer can only be done if the game sells out and Arsenal change £1 to do that.
